Greatest Hits: Dr. Ben Fishbein – 30 Years Of Practice In 7 Years10 Oct 202300:47:04

Orthodontics is a remarkable profession that offers practitioners various avenues to shape their careers and practices.

Some orthodontists choose to practice independently, while others opt for large group practices. In today's discussion, we delve into the inspiring story of Dr. Ben Fishbein, a visionary orthodontist who has achieved remarkable success by leveraging hard work and strategic thinking.

Dr. Fishbein's journey is a testament to the power of determination and smart practice management.

In 2013, Dr. Fishbein purchased a small practice with just seven team members.

This small endeavor would eventually grow into an orthodontic empire consisting of eight offices and employing 94 dedicated team members by the time he joined Smile Doctors DSO in 2020.

This incredible growth occurred over approximately seven years, showcasing Dr. Fishbein's commitment and work ethic.

He emphasizes that before scaling your practice, it's crucial to determine what kind of lifestyle you desire. This self-awareness serves as the foundation for your orthodontic journey.

While his path may not align with everyone's goals, Dr. Fishbein believes tailoring your practice to your desired lifestyle is essential.

One of the key takeaways from Dr. Fishbein's story is the concept of working hard for certain points in your career to achieve your dreams.

His determination and willingness to put in the hours allowed him to achieve tremendous growth over a short period of time.

His wife humorously notes that he put in 30 years of orthodontics in seven years while he worked tirelessly to expand his practice.

Greatest Hits: Why Did the Schulman Group Become a DSO and What Does That Mean?03 Oct 202300:51:27

When the news broke that the group formerly known as the Schulman Group had transformed into a Dental Support Organization (DSO), many of us were left scratching our heads.

What prompted this transition, and what does it mean for the members and the orthodontic profession as a whole?

In this episode, we chat with guests Chris Vranas, the Executive Director of SG Management, and Dr. Robert Bray, the President and CEO, to shed light on the decision and its implications.

The Schulman Group began as a study group in the 1980s and underwent a significant transformation in 2018.

It rebranded as a member-owned Dental Support Organization, known as SSG Management LLC, but informally referred to as "SG."

This shift was pivotal, as it marked a departure from the traditional study group model towards something more innovative, future-looking, and member-focused.

The organization is now independently owned by its members, who each hold an equal share in this orthodontic DSO.

So, what exactly does SG Management offer its members?

The answer lies in the advantages of being part of this unique DSO while still maintaining independent practice ownership.

Through collective purchasing power, preferred supplier agreements, and non-clinical practice management solutions, SG Management provides its member shareholders with competitive pricing and services.

But here's the key: members continue to run their own patient-centered practices. They are not even required to do business with the preferred providers.

In other words, SG Management preserves the essence of individual practice while enhancing it with the resources and benefits of a DSO.

In addition, members navigate the ever-changing marketplace by exchanging real-world clinical experience and practice management expertise.

In orthodontics, the name Dr. Luis Carriere is synonymous with innovation, clinical expertise, and a commitment to advancing the field.

While many may associate his name with the Carriere Motion Class II and Class III corrector, Dr. Carriere is much more than an inventor. He is a master clinician, a gentleman of the highest order, and a second-generation orthodontist following in the footsteps of his renowned father.

In this Greatest Hits Series, we revisit a popular episode where he graciously shared his insights into different clinical aspects of orthodontics.

Among these clinical aspects we talk about is the crucial role of the tongue in malocclusions and overall oral health.

The improper positioning of the tongue during functions like swallowing, chewing, and speaking can contribute to malocclusions and open bites.

Dr. Carriere stresses the importance of training patients to reposition their tongues correctly. Understanding and addressing the tongue's role in orthodontics is essential for achieving long-term stability and preventing relapse.

Demystifying Private Equity and Orthodontic Practice Acquisition w/ Michael Kruspe19 Sep 202300:44:45

The orthodontic industry is currently only about 10% consolidated, which means that a relatively small percentage of practices are part of organized groups or dental support organizations (DSOs)

However, this landscape is evolving rapidly, with more and more practices considering the possibility of private equity-backed partnerships.

Unfortunately, there is loads of misinformation and misconceptions that make it hard for people to understand how private equity-backed DSOs work properly.

To shed light on this often misunderstood topic, we sat down with Michael Kruspe, Chief Development Officer at Smile Doctors, the largest orthodontic-focused DSO in the U.S.

Private equity is a form of financing in the private markets. Unlike venture capital, which typically supports startups and new ideas, private equity focuses on mature businesses.

These businesses are already profitable and have established revenue streams. Private equity firms pool resources from private investors to invest in these companies with a track record.

One of the intriguing aspects of private equity in orthodontics is the recurring four to five-year timeline. Michael sheds light on why this timeframe is crucial.

Private equity firms aim to invest in orthodontic practices, help them grow, and eventually move them to a more capitalized private equity firm. This process typically takes four to five years.

Michael predicts that similar to general dentistry, orthodontics will eventually see a higher level of consolidation, potentially reaching 35% or more. This underscores the early-stage nature of the industry's transformation.
